Ingredients

  • Chicken Breast1 whole
  • Neutral frying oil2 quarts
  • Egg white1
  • Flour1.5 cups
  • Brown Sugar1 tablespoon
  • Salt1 tablespoon
  • paprika1 tablespoon
  • Onion salt2 teaspoons
  • chili powder1 teaspoon
  • Black Pepper1 teaspoon
  • Celery salt0.5 teaspoon
  • Sage0.5 teaspoon
  • Garlic powder0.5 teaspoon
  • Allspice0.5 teaspoon
  • Oregano0.5 teaspoon
  • Basil0.5 teaspoon
  • Marjoram0.5 teaspoon

Instructions

  1. Preheat the Fryer

    1 min

    Set your fryer to heat up to 350°F (175°C). This temperature is crucial for achieving that crispy exterior while ensuring the chicken cooks through properly.

  2. Prepare the Spice Mix

    4 min

    In a mixing bowl, thoroughly combine the paprika, onion salt, chili powder, black pepper, celery salt, sage, garlic powder, allspice, oregano, basil, and marjoram. This spice blend will infuse the chicken with rich flavors.

  3. Combine Flour and Seasoning

    8 min

    In the same bowl, add 1 1/2 cups of flour, 1 tablespoon of brown sugar, and 1 tablespoon of salt to the spice mix. Stir the mixture well until all ingredients are evenly distributed, creating a seasoned flour blend.

  4. Coat Chicken with Egg White

    4 min

    Take the egg white and use it to lightly coat the pieces of the whole chicken. This step helps the flour mixture adhere better to the chicken, enhancing the crunch of the crust.

  5. Dredge Chicken in Flour Mixture

    4 min

    Carefully dredge the egg-coated chicken pieces in the seasoned flour mixture, ensuring each piece is evenly coated. Shake off any excess flour to prevent clumping.

  6. Rest Coated Chicken

    4 min

    Let the coated chicken pieces sit for about 5 minutes. This resting period allows the flour to set, which contributes to a better crust during frying.

  7. Fry the Chicken

    22 min

    Fry the chicken in batches to avoid overcrowding, cooking the breasts and wings for about 12-14 minutes. For legs and thighs, cook slightly longer, ensuring the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C) for safe consumption.

  8. Drain and Serve Chicken

    1 min

    Once the chicken is cooked, remove it from the fryer and let it drain on paper towels to absorb excess oil. Serve hot to enjoy the crispy, flavorful fried chicken at its best!
